With my pictures, I try to go beyond the touristic clichè of Prague as the “Golden City”. I seek the arcane substance, the ambiguities, numbness of
the Central European decadence, the hidden charm of Bohemia.
The glittering windows of its famous crystals, the McDonald's - expression of homogenizing modernity, contrast with old beer halls. If you look closely through the ceselled glass of the empty mugs, you'll see glimpses of elegant and wicked women in the shape of “liberty” statuettes. Gotic and Liberty. The Middle Ages and the “Belle Epoque”. They still look at each other, to remind us of a past of bloody religious wars, esoteric alchemy on one side and joy of life and passion for the arts on the other.
